Criteria for Evaluating Top CNC Machining Factories

When evaluating CNC machining factories, several criteria prove essential. Quality control is paramount. A factory should implement rigorous inspection processes. This ensures that specifications are met consistently. According to a recent industry report, 70% of clients prioritize defect rates under 2%. Meeting this benchmark demonstrates reliability.

Another crucial factor is technology. Advanced CNC machines enhance precision and efficiency. Factories that invest in cutting-edge equipment often report shorter lead times. Statistically, firms utilizing modern machinery experience a 30% increase in production capacity. This improvement directly impacts their competitiveness in the market.

Supplier communication plays a vital role too. Transparent and frequent updates streamline project management. In cases where communication is lacking, misunderstandings lead to costly delays. Data suggests that 65% of production issues arise from poor communication practices. Evaluating a factory’s communication style can save time and money, ensuring a smoother workflow.

Sustainability Practices in Top CNC Machining Factories

Sustainability is transforming the CNC machining industry. Many factories now prioritize eco-friendly processes. They focus on reducing waste and optimizing resource use. Energy-efficient machines are becoming standard. This shift lowers carbon footprints significantly.

Water management practices are critical. Some factories recycle coolant used in machining. This reduces water waste and lowers operational costs. However, not all factories implement this effectively. Regular audits and improvements are necessary to ensure sustainability goals are met.

Employee training plays a vital role. Educating staff about green practices helps cultivate a sustainable mindset. Some factories struggle to engage employees fully. This lack of engagement can hinder progress. Continuous feedback loops could enhance involvement and commitment to sustainability initiatives.
